Course Details
• <strong>Satire Techniques</strong>: An overview of various satire techniques used in professional comedy, including irony, sarcasm, exaggeration, and caricature.<br> • <strong>Comedy Writing</strong>: Fundamentals of comedy writing, including joke structure, timing, and misdirection.<br> • <strong>Comedic Characters</strong>: Creating and developing comedic characters, including stereotypes, archetypes, and eccentric personalities.<br> • <strong>Political Satire</strong>: Understanding and applying satire in political contexts, including commentary on current events, social issues, and public figures.<br> • <strong>Parody and Satire</strong>: Distinguishing between parody and satire, and using parody effectively in comedy writing.<br> • <strong>Satire in Media</strong>: Exploring various forms of satire in media, including television, film, print, and online platforms.<br> • <strong>Comedic Timing</strong>: Mastering comedic timing and delivery for maximum impact.<br> • <strong>Satire and Censorship</strong>: Understanding the legal and ethical considerations of satire, including issues of censorship and freedom of speech.<br> • <strong>Satire and Social Change</strong>: Examining the role of satire in social change, including its power to challenge authority, provoke thought, and inspire action.
